Missouri DeMolay Conclave Sports Rulebook
General Rules 1. In order to participate in any sports events, players must compete in two ritual events. If a player does not meet ritual requirements, the player forfeits all individual and team sports. If an unqualified player participates in team sports, the team will forfeit the game. 2. For all divisional events, the category will be determined as follows: a player is to give their age as of the date Conclave begins i.e. Friday evening. Players 15 and below will be in the Junior division and players 16 and up will be in the Senior division. 3. In the case of a tie, winners will be based on Sports Officials discretion. Sports Officials will consider player participation in sports, ritual, personal conduct and attitude during Conclave. 4. A sports official will be assigned to each court to keep score and maintain team player rosters. All name badges of DeMolay who will be playing the game need to be turned into the sport official in order to record players names on the game rosters. 5. Time will be set to Dad Absheer s watch. 6. Athlete of the Year will be determined by the individual DeMolay who earns the most awards. 7. Individual and Sportsmanship Awards will be determined based on the Sports Officials and State Officers discretion. 8. The Overall Sports Champion will be determined by the Chapter who earns the most awards. Basketball - Team Event a minimum of 5 players are required for play - Team rosters must be filled out on an individual game basis. - Games consist of two 10 minute halves with a 5 minute halftime - Clock will continuously run Billiards - Individual Event, single elimination - Players will not be divided by division, the top three individuals will be awarded trophies - If a player is not present within 15 minutes of slotted start time for billiards, player forfeits the right to play - Games will have a ten minute time limit - Scratch on the break, game continues shooter forfeits turn - There is no ball in hand - If you scratch while making a shot, the sunken ball(s) come out - If a player taps the cue ball on a shot, player does not lose their turn - If a player makes their shot and then sinks the opponent s ball, the player continues their turn - If a player sinks the opponent s ball and then makes their shot, player loses their turn - You must call the pocket for an 8 ball shot - Scratch on the 8 ball, game over shooter loses - When the game is finished, winning player needs to report to Sports Official present
Bowling - Team and Individual Event - Team events require 4 players per team. Top 4 bowlers will form players for 1 st team chapter; Next 4 top scores will form 2 nd team chapter, etc. - Multiple chapter teams are allowed - Top 3 individual bowlers will be awarded trophies - Score sheets must include Chapter name and all players first and last names. - Incomplete bowling score sheets will be disqualified. Turn score sheets into any Sports Official - Adults are allowed to bowl however, scores will not count - Missouri DeMolay will pay for shoe rental and one game. Players are welcome to continue to play at their own cost - An advisor from each Chapter MUST monitor how many games members play after their free one. Chapters will be held responsible for any costs after that. Dodgeball - Team Event no more than 5 players on the court at one time - Majority vote from Chapters will determine game to be played; one vote per chapter - Team rosters must be filled out on an individual game basis. - Teams can be made up of a maximum of 6 players with up to 4 substitutions - The same 10* players must play all matches in the tournament (*up to 10 players) - Substitutions must be made prior to the start of the game; no substitutions can be made during a game, except in the cases of injury - Teams will designate retrievers for ball that go out of bounds. Retrievers cannot be active players. Retrievers may be players who are deemed out. Retrievers may not enter the court at any time. Retrievers are only allowed to field balls from their side of the court. - A match will be considered won from the best 2/3 game win bases OR by the most members on a side at the end of 7 minutes
- Upon official s signal, both teams rush to center court and attempt to retrieve as many balls as possible. A team may rush with as many or as few of their members. There is no limit to how many balls an individual player may retrieve. - Crossing over the center line at the beginning of a game will result in an out - Player may not slide or dive head first to get a ball from the center line - After retrieval of a ball at the start of a game, a player must go completely behind the attack line before the ball is live - There are no time outs - A player shall be deemed out: (i) when a live-thrown ball hits any part of the player s body or clothing; (ii) if a player is hit by a live-thrown ball rebounding off another player or (iii) if an offensive player throws a ball and the ball is caught by defending team - Players can defend themselves by blocking the ball in flight with another ball but must retain control over the ball they are blocking with. A player dropping or losing possession of the blocking ball is deemed out - An official can determine if a player or team or both teams are stalling and will give a warning. Upon refusal to actively play, the official may call a player - If a defensive player catches a live-thrown ball, then a teammate comes back into play for the defensive team - Headshots are not counted as an out but are frowned upon doing and the official has fair cause to call a player out if they persist on throwing headshots Free Throw Shot - Individual Event before beginning event, player will need to give their name, chapter and age to Sports Official - Player shoots 15 shots from the free throw line - If a player steps over the line before shot is thrown, shot is disqualified - If there is a tie, player with the most consecutive shots made wins. If a tie still results, winners will be based on Sports Officials discretion. Three Point Shot - Individual Event before beginning event, player will need to give their name, chapter and age to Sports Official - Player shoots 10 shots from anywhere on the 3-point line
- If player steps over the line before shot is thrown, shot is disqualified - If there is a tie, player with the most consecutive shots made wins. If tie still results, winners will be based on Sports Officials discretion Track Events - Individual track events include 50, 100, 200, 400, 800 and 1 mile in Junior and Senior divisions - Team track events include 400 relay. 4 players needed to participate - Players must be present within 10 minutes of start time in order to participate - For all events, winners will need to give their name, chapter and age to Sports Official - Long Jump Runner gets three attempts, the best jump counts. If jumper crosses the line before they jump, jump is disqualified Tug of War - Double Elimination - Tug of War will be separated out into Junior and Senior divisions. Chapters that do not have enough members to compete in a division need to get DeMolays from another chapter - There will be a two team maximum per Chapter in each division - Team must consist of 5 players but no more than 6 - Teams must have equal number of participants before game begins - Team must be present within 5 minutes of start time in order to participate. All team members must be present to play - Game begins on Sports Official whistle - Gloves may not be used in any games - Team player rosters must be filled out before tournament starts. Players must stay with the same team and not be on multiple teams. Volleyball - Team Event minimum of 4 players are required for play, no more than 6 on the court at one time - Best of 3 games to 15 points. Must win by at least 2 points
- Time limit is 25 minutes for play - Rally point scoring will be used - Team player roster must be filled out on an individual game basis. Overall Sports Champion Scoring Chapters will be awarded points towards their overall score based on the following: - Team Sport 1 st Place 7 Points - Team Sport 2 nd Place 5 Points - Team Sport 3 rd Place 3 Points - Individual Place Awards 1 Point each
